Standard paper or 100 lb. As you may know standard copy paper that youll find in your everday printer is 20 pound paper. In general Id recommend using 24 lbs paper for printing your resume.
White is a standard paper shade that prints well no matter the elements you may include on your resume. Since heavier-weighted paper helps make your resume seem more professional this weight is often the best to stand out among other resumes printed on lower-weighted paper.
